High-clarity silicone tubing is sensitive to deviations at every stage of production, and the impact of any shortcoming is immediately visible in the finished tube as haze, cloudiness, or color shift. On raw materials, medical-grade or optical-grade base polymer is required, free of impurities; reinforcing fillers must be selected and dispersed to avoid introducing scattering particles. On vulcanization, platinum-catalyzed addition cure is the only practical choice — peroxide-cured tubing produces byproducts that degrade transparency progressively over time. Temperature uniformity across the mixing, extrusion, and cure stages must be tightly controlled; localized overheating generates gel inclusions that act as scattering centers in the tube wall. On the production environment, particulate contamination is the primary quality risk for clear tubing: forming and packaging must be done in a cleanroom to prevent foreign particles from becoming embedded in or adhering to the tube surface.
